Subject: bug#2218: 23.0.90; current cvs fails with message "Invalid script or charset name: mathematical-bold"

Current CVS fails to start on OS X; no Emacs windows appears and the
following message appears in the shell:
~/Source/gnu/emacs[master]$ nextstep/Emacs.app/Contents/MacOS/Emacs -Q
Invalid script or charset name: mathematical-bold
Reverting to git version 99d9b340834cc7c5588e623aace85bf98feb27ad
gives me a working version, so I suspect this commit:
2009-02-05 Kenichi Handa <handa@m17n.org>
* international/fontset.el (script-representative-chars): Remove
mathematical.
(setup-default-fontset): Add entries for each subgroup of
mathematical script.
